Browse The Substantial Web Services Manual For A Complete Expedition Of Interaction Protocols, Essential Principles, And Industry-Standard Methods
Browse The Substantial Web Services Manual For A Complete Expedition Of Interaction Protocols, Essential Principles, And Industry-Standard Methods
Blog Article
Created By-Greenwood Diaz
Discover the ultimate Web Solutions Manual for all your requirements. Check out communication protocols, core concepts of SOAP and REST, and ideal methods for smooth execution. Uncover the tricks to mastering web services, from recognizing the fundamentals to applying scalable style. visit the up coming internet page of creating safe systems and optimizing for future development. Unlock the power of web services within your reaches.
Summary of Internet Providers
If you have actually ever before wondered what web services are and exactly how they work, this overview is the excellent place to start. Web solutions are a way for different applications to interact with each other over the internet. They enable smooth integration of systems, making it simpler to share data and performances.
One of the crucial elements of internet services is their use typical procedures like HTTP and XML to facilitate communication. This standardization makes certain that various systems can understand and connect with each other properly. Web solutions can be classified into 2 main kinds: SOAP (Simple Object Access Protocol) and REST (Representational State Transfer).
SOAP is a protocol that makes use of XML for message exchange, while remainder relies on conventional HTTP methods like GET, POST, PUT, and remove. Both have their strengths and are used in various circumstances based on requirements.
Key Concepts and Technologies
Exploring the foundational ideas and modern technologies of web solutions is crucial for comprehending their functionality and application in contemporary systems. When diving into the vital principles and innovations of web solutions, you open the door to a globe of interconnected possibilities. https://define-content-marketing40628.blog5star.com/30262953/master-the-art-of-bring-in-neighboring-clients-with-regional-search-engine-optimization-methods-yet-do-not-overlook-the-international-reach-potential-of-typical-search-engine-optimization-uncover-the-key-distinctions are some essential elements to comprehend:
- ** SOAP (Simple Object Access Procedure) **: This method defines the structure of messages traded between internet solutions.
- ** WSDL (Internet Providers Summary Language) **: WSDL is used to explain the performances provided by an internet solution.
- ** REMAINDER (Representational State Transfer) **: An architectural style that uses typical HTTP approaches for communication between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ial role in data exchange in between internet solutions due to its convenience and readability.
Understanding these core ideas and innovations will certainly lay a solid structure for your journey right into the world of internet solutions.
Best Practices for Implementation
To guarantee successful application of web solutions, prioritize adherence to ideal techniques. Begin by completely recording your web solution APIs, consisting of clear descriptions of endpoints, criteria, and anticipated responses. Regular calling conventions and versioning of APIs are essential for maintainability. When developing your internet services, follow the principles of remainder to develop a scalable and flexible style. Implement proper authentication and permission devices to protect your solutions, such as OAuth or API secrets.
Checking is vital in ensuring the integrity of your internet solutions. Develop detailed test cases that cover different situations, consisting of positive and negative testing. Constant integration and automated screening can aid catch concerns early in the development process. Display your web services in real-time to determine efficiency traffic jams and possible failures. Logging and error handling are important for detecting issues and fixing issues successfully.
Finally, consider the scalability of your web services by designing for future growth. Implement caching systems and lots harmonizing to take care of raised web traffic. Routinely testimonial and maximize your code for efficiency. By adhering to these ideal techniques, you can enhance the execution of web solutions and ensure their success.
Conclusion
Congratulations! You have actually simply opened the secret to mastering web solutions. By understanding the key ideas and innovations, and implementing ideal practices, you're well on your way to ending up being an internet services professional.
Maintain discovering and explore what you have actually discovered to continue broadening your expertise and skills in this interesting field.
The world of web services is currently at your fingertips, all set for you to discover and conquer. Delight in the trip!
